On August 1, 1996, dozens of witnesses in France observed a very bright white ball with a yellow and green trail. The phenomenon, which lasted about thirty seconds, was seen from the Cantal to Alsace. Although the reported times vary slightly, the observation occurred between 21:30 and 21:45, with the object moving toward the northwest. The uniform description of the phenomenon suggests it was widely visible.
GEIPAN researchers classified the case as "B," indicating a likely explanation. Although other hypotheses are not ruled out, the most plausible explanation is that it was an object entering Earth's atmosphere. This type of phenomenon, while unusual, can be explained with current scientific knowledge.
